The Hanseatic League: A Historical Trade Community
The Hanseatic League emerged while in the 12th century as German retailers sought safety and mutual advantage through collective action. What commenced as informal agreements in between traders in coastal cities developed into certainly one of record’s most complex industrial networks. By the thirteenth century, this alliance experienced transformed Northern Europe trade right into a powerhouse of economic action that would dominate the area for more than three hundreds of years.
Geographic Attain and Regulate
The League’s geographic achieve stretched throughout an impressive expanse of maritime territory. Baltic Sea commerce shaped the jap backbone of functions, connecting towns like Riga, Reval (present day-working day Tallinn), and Danzig (Gdańsk). The network extended westward with the North Sea, developing crucial buying and selling posts in London, Bergen, and Bruges. This strategic positioning allowed the League to control critical waterways and establish monopolies on critical trade routes between Eastern and Western Europe.

Funds on the Industrial Empire
Lübeck stood since the undisputed money of the business empire. Started in 1143, the city’s strategic location over the Trave River built it the pure hub for coordinating League functions. The city hosted the Hansetag, the assembly exactly where representatives from member towns gathered to make collective conclusions. Lübeck’s legal code, known as Lübeck Legislation, became the template for municipal governance throughout dozens of Baltic and North Sea towns. The town’s retailers didn’t just facilitate trade—they established the institutional framework that manufactured big-scale Northern Europe trade probable.

The significance of Lüneburg Salt
At the heart of the buying and selling network was Lüneburg salt, regarded as the most respected commodity. The salt mines near Lüneburg manufactured “white gold” that revolutionized food preservation and reworked regional economies. Total cities thrived because of their Management above salt distribution routes.

Kontors as Professional and Diplomatic Hubs
The kontors ended up a Bodily representation of Hanseatic energy throughout medieval Europe, a testomony towards the influence in the Hanseatic League. These fortified trading posts operated as unbiased merchant communities, comprehensive with storage facilities, dwelling spaces, and administrative places of work. They are often noticed as early variations of modern embassies coupled with commercial centers—places where by small business and diplomacy seamlessly merged.
The Steelyard London was perhaps the most very well-recognized kontor, occupying primary property alongside the Thames River from the 13th century onwards. Within its partitions, German retailers carried out small business In line with their own rules and customs, maintaining a unique identification when functioning inside a international place. The compound included:
Secure storage places for worthwhile merchandise
Conference rooms for negotiating contracts
Living quarters with strict bachelor-only guidelines
Private chapels and communal dining spaces
